I received my LEE reloader press. This is their cheapest. $20 and it comes with their Modern Reloading manual. There is a definate reason it's so cheap, because it's, well, cheap.

However, I got it because I had a specific function in mind for it and because it is cheap.

I do all of my reloading on a RCBS 4X4 Auto. That thing is a honkin' piece of steel! Great press but it's progressive. I use it as a single stage. RCBS doesn't even make this press anymore. It will be great if I ever start reloading pistol rounds.

Anyway, the swager die will not work in a progressive. So, I picked up the LEE and it's now dedicated to decapping and swaging. It seems to be perfect for the job with very little investment.
